"Il Canto dei Sanfedisti" is a Neapolitan Folk Song which was born out of the turbulent year 1799, when the Kingdom of Naples was briefly overthrown by invading French revolutionary forces and replaced with the failed and short lived Parthenopean Republic. Sung by the Sanfedisti, "the Soldiers of the Holy Faith", this piece represents the voice of the common people and clergy in southern Italy who were lead by Cardinal Fabrizio Ruffo and rose up in armed resistance against the French armies to restore the monarchy, and to defend themselves against social upheaval, Jacobin atheism, and foreign occupation. This song, which is rich in satire and contemporary idiomatic expression, celebrates the uprising of the 'populo bascio' and mocks the republican elite who had attempted to impose enlightenment ideals upon a catholic society. The verses of this piece recounts the major events and sentiments of the Neapolitan Counter-Revolution of 1799. Behind the lyrical humour lies a serious reflection on loyalty, faith and cultural resistance. Despite it's modern popularity, this song was originally composed anonymously in the wake of Sanfedisti victory, and has survived through oral tradition and writing. Furthermore, it remains a rare window into the vernacular culture of early 18th century southern Italy, and stands out not only as a historical document of popular royalism and anti-revolutionary attitude, but as a folk anthem of resistance.
